Colorado Non-Hispanic Asian Alone Citizen Voting-age Population By County in 2011 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on March 28, 2026.

Based on the US Census Bureau's special tabulation from the ACS 5-year estimates, in 2011, the Non-Hispanic Asian Alone citizen voting-age population for Colorado was 22,655 and represented 0.65% of the total Colorado citizen voting-age population.

Among all Colorado counties, Arapahoe had the highest Non-Hispanic Asian Alone citizen voting-age population (13.39K), followed by Denver (10.12K), and El Paso (9.45K).

In terms of percentages, Arapahoe had the highest percentage of its citizen voting-age population being Non-Hispanic Asian Alone (3.62%), followed by Broomfield (3.35%), and Adams (3.00%).
